Output ef62effd89a372bd942c939c82ca6c1dada778140231758e60beedb1bcdaf871:194

value
1625544
script pubkey
OP_0 OP_PUSHBYTES_20 28c0ad27e3183f66fd7addcabac8d468d6d9f12c
address
bc1q9rq26flrrqlkdlt6mh9t4jx5drtdnufvdste93
transaction
ef62effd89a372bd942c939c82ca6c1dada778140231758e60beedb1bcdaf871